October 31, Day of the Dead
On November 1 and 2, everything is prepared to receive the faithful departed, the first for the children and the second for the adults who have gone before them. Families place offerings in their homes with the 4 elements - fire (candlelight), earth (pots of Cempaxúchitl, a typical Day of the Dead flower), water (in a container) and air (chopped multicolored paper) - favorite food, candies, fruits, photographs and sugar skulls with the names of the family members. This night is a time to share with those who have passed away, remembering the stories and memories.

November 22, EFFIE AWARDS 2023
The advertising and marketing industry presents the EFFIE Awards each year in 17 different categories. Centro Mexicano Alzheimer is honored to receive the award in the category of non-profit institutions with positive impact for Mariachiterapia, El Mariachi del Recuerdo campaign that took place in 2022 with the pro bono sponsorship of the agency MullenLowe SSP3 Mexico.
